When we got to Epcot, I took a few pictures and then we were on our way to the Rose & Crown for our 12:20 lunch reservation. We were meeting my cousins with their 9-month old. They were slightly delayed because of a bug problem in their hotel room. But they got there just in time.


We got seated outside and right on the water. There was a nice cool breeze which made it extra comfortable. I like being on the water there.

I got the bangers and mash like usual and it was delicious...also as usual. I didn't write down what everyone else got. But it was a nice relaxing meal.



We did end up having to ask for our check because we were pushing it for our Soarin' FastPasses.

The FP line was actually like a 20-30 minute wait but that's ok. Lisa (my cousin) waited outside with the baby. They were planning on doing rider swap,  but we ended up running out of time.

This was my first time on the new Soarin'. I liked the new video. The Taj Mahal had my favorite smell. But it still gave me anxiety. I just always have to prepare myself for this ride. And I probably can only ride it one time.

We were going to ride Imagination but it was like 2:30 and we needed to get to Fort Wilderness by 3:30. So, I swung by Starbucks to pick up my bag and ad called a Minnie Van. 


We said good-bye to Epcot for the last time this trip and were off.
